Section 6(5) in The West Bengal Entertainment-Cum-Amusement Tax Act, 1982

(5)Any holder of a [television set, video cassette recorder set or video cassette player set] [Words substituted by W.B. Act 15 of 1983.], who has paid the tax in respect of that set and claims that he shall not use or he has not used that set throughout the year, for which the tax is paid, may apply to the prescribed authority in the prescribed form for a certificate of exemption from payment of tax for the relevant year. If the prescribed authority is satisfied, on such enquiry as it deems fit, that the claim is proved by the applicant, it may grant the certificate of exemption to the applicant, subject to such terms and conditions as may be prescribed.
